Output e6be4c394393aff35e2bfa3c9d620726524d91d2e068cf2c7e4da4d609c4a9f3:0

value
6956590107167
script pubkey
OP_0 OP_PUSHBYTES_20 9030fdefbc859dd88457d131274a41fe8814e5d0
address
tb1qjqc0mmauskwa3pzh6ycjwjjpl6ypfewsll8lxn
transaction
e6be4c394393aff35e2bfa3c9d620726524d91d2e068cf2c7e4da4d609c4a9f3
confirmations
169536
spent
true